SIP-based Interactive Voice Response System using FreeSwitch EPBX
Accessing information during a call without having to open up a web browser in a phone is not only easier but also efficient in time-constraint situations. To achieve this, we have implemented an Interactive Voice Response System (IVRS) for SIP-based phones. Telecommunication services plays a vital role in exchange of information. Although this system is limited to SIP-based phones, we propose a general IVRS that can be implemented for a regular network operator.
